Working Principles

The LCMXO640E-4BN256I operates based on the principles of reconfigurable digital logic. It consists of an array of configurable logic blocks interconnected through programmable routing resources. The user programs the FPGA to define the desired digital circuit functionality by configuring the logic elements and interconnections.
